Yeah, those "free" tickets they offer for bumping come out of the same inventory as the frequent flyer mile tickets do. And more and more the airlines aren't letting you switch to the voucher after the fact (so good luck there, Nick). I won't take a bump unless they are specifically giving the $ off voucher and will tell anyone who is considering taking said offer what they are getting. Needless to say I've had some ticked off gate agents when the "suckers" (I mean volunteers) turn them down after they talk to me.
